UGANDA PREMIER LEAGUE 

The Date: April 3rd, 2025

The Contest: Vipers SC vs. Lugazi FC

The Time: 7pm

The Venue: St Mary’s Stadium

Vipers SC will be back at home, the St. Mary’s Stadium, Kitende, as they play host to Lugazi FC in the StarTimes Uganda Premier League under the floodlights, this Thursday.

The Venoms will want to make a quick turnaround from their previous glitch, when they suffered a 1-0 defeat at the hands of SC Villa last week.

Despite last week’s loss, we still top proceedings in the league with 49 points, two ahead of the nearest chasers NEC FC, after 21 matches.

Meanwhile, Lugazi FC suffered a 1-0 defeat to Maroons last week on Friday, and they subsequently sit 11th on the 16-team log, with 26 points.

Vipers are yet to lose a game this season in the Uganda Premier League at home, as we have won seven, with seven stalemates. The team has scored 14 goals and conceded just four at the St. Mary’s Stadium, Kitende.

In the previous Uganda Premier League game at home, we smiled to a 1-0 victory over Wakiso Giants FC, courtesy of old boy Kenneth Kimera.

Tomorrow’s tie will be the second time in history that Vipers play Lugazi in a competitive match across all competitions. The first was in the first round, as the two played out a barren stalemate in Najjembe.

Team News:

Midfielder Karim Watambala is back in the squad after serving his one match ban for accumulating three yellow cards.

Team captain Milton Karisa is training but won’t be rushed back into the squad as they are still some pre-cautions he has to go through.

Congolese forward Gusto Mulongo is still out as he’s still struggling with a hamstring injury.

Left back Derrick Ndahiro, still not close as he continues to battle back from his head injury.
